Synopsis
Jim is nervous about moving from the baby pool to the middle-sized pool. To help him overcome his fear, his mum uses dinosaurs to explain the water's depth. As Jim learns about different water depths—from the bathtub to the deepest oceans—he gains the confidence to take the plunge. This engaging story combines a child's swimming journey with fascinating dinosaur facts, making it both educational and reassuring.
